Storm Ciara to bring severe gales
Sailings are in doubt for three days from tomorrow morning.
Every one from tomorrow's scheduled 8.45am journey to Heysham to Monday's 2.15pm sailing from the Lancashire port is subject to possible disruption or cancellation.
A decision on the first of those will be made by 7am tomorrow.
Storm Ciara is expected to bring gales and severe gales to the Irish Sea tomorrow, Sunday and Monday.
